You could look into the PIPE forum to fond a very recent discussion on the
subject....

Or here an extract with my notes with programming tips
*========================================================================
[MENU:ROOT] [NAME:WORKUNIT]
[TITLE:How to handle Workunit problems with SFS files]
[MODEL: /* PIPE STATE fn ft dirid | ... leaves workunit open if the file]
[MODEL: |  is found.  This then results in:                             ]
[MODEL: |    DMSQRQ1157E Work unit already active when atomic request...]
[MODEL: |  Solution: commit the workunit.   Example                     ]
[MODEL: |      'PIPE LITERAL T T .|STATE ISODATE|CONS'                  ]
[MODEL: |      call csl 'DMSCOMM RETC REAS'; say retc reas              ]
[MODEL: |      'CMDCALL QUERY LIMITS *'  /* Would fail without DMSCOMM*/]
[MODEL: */                                                              ]
[MODEL: /* Similar, when a file is open and a workunit is active, some  ]
[MODEL: |  cmds give: DMSQRQ1157E Work unit already active when atomic..]
[MODEL: |  Solution: get a new workunit.   Example                      ]
[MODEL: |      call csl 'DMSGETWU RETC REAS WID1' /* Get a workunit */  ]
[MODEL: |      call csl 'DMSPUSWU RETC REAS WID1' /* Start using it */  ]
[MODEL: |      'CMDCALL QUERY LIMITS *'                                 ]
[MODEL: |      call csl 'DMSPOPWU RETC REAS'      /* Use prev Wunit */  ]
[MODEL: |      call csl 'DMSRETWU RETC REAS WID1' /* Delete new Wunit */]
[MODEL: */                                                              ]
[END:WORKUNIT]

2011/8/22 Frank M. Ramaekers <[email protected]>

> I don't quite understand why I'm getting this:
>
>
>
>   463 *-*              "PIPE LITERAL QUERY ENROLL USER FOR ALL"
> !._WorkPool "| CMS | STEM QE."
>
>       >L>                "PIPE LITERAL QUERY ENROLL USER FOR ALL"
>
>
>       >V>                "VMSYSA:"
>
>
>       >O>                "PIPE LITERAL QUERY ENROLL USER FOR ALL
> VMSYSA:"
>
>       >L>                "| CMS | STEM QE."
>
>
>       >O>                "PIPE LITERAL QUERY ENROLL USER FOR ALL
> VMSYSA: | CMS | STEM QE."
>
>       +++ RC(70) +++
>
>
> 'QUERY ENROLL USER FOR ALL VMSYSA:'
>
>
> DMSQRE1157E Work unit already active when atomic request is issued for
> work unit 1
>
>
>
>  Frank M. Ramaekers Jr.
>
>
>
>
>
> Systems Programmer
>
> MCP, MCP+I, MCSE & RHCE
>
>
>
> American Income Life Insurance Co.
>
> Phone: (254)761-6649
>
>
>
> 1200 Wooded Acres Dr.
>
> Fax: (254)741-5777
>
>
>
> Waco, Texas  76701
>
>
>
>
>
>
>
>
>
>
> _____________________________________________________
> This message contains information which is privileged and confidential and
> is solely for the use of the
> intended recipient. If you are not the intended recipient, be aware that
> any review, disclosure,
> copying, distribution, or use of the contents of this message is strictly
> prohibited. If you have
> received this in error, please destroy it immediately and notify us at
> [email protected].
>



--
Kris Buelens,
IBM Belgium, VM customer support

Reply via email to